你查询的IP:[121.51.86.104]  地理位置:中国–上海–上海

最新查询58.116.240.36 118.124.13.97 161.207.20.7 58.32.199.227 210.2.10.123 59.191.251.239 118.80.79.21 118.64.203.220 116.4.34.239 121.51.86.104 119.2.144.39 58.24.136.30 202.69.16.249 60.63.174.217 117.72.217.125 202.127.112.188 121.52.160.231 202.122.128.194 203.158.16.249 202.38.164.246 58.16.98.156 211.96.73.247 203.128.96.157 121.100.128.246 202.95.11.139 116.213.64.107 202.170.216.59 121.100.128.191 202.92.252.46 60.253.128.33 218.249.220.156